How electrical surges affect your AC
An electrical surge sends a short burst of high voltage into your home. Lightning strikes, utility problems, power outages, and sudden power restoration may trigger these spikes. Your AC unit contains several electrical parts that rely on stable voltage.
A surge may burn wiring, damage control boards, weaken capacitors, or affect the compressor motor. Some damage appears right away. Other problems develop slowly as damaged parts lose their normal performance. Your AC may still run after a surge, but its cooling performance may drop.
Signs of surge-related ac damage
Pay attention to changes after a power spike. An AC that suddenly struggles to cool your rooms may have electrical damage. You may also notice frequent shutdowns, buzzing sounds, burning smells, or unusual startup behavior. A tripped breaker also deserves attention.
The breaker protects your system from electrical problems, so repeated trips may point to damaged components. Ignoring these signs may place extra strain on healthy parts and increase repair costs.
Why quick AC service matters
A trained technician checks the electrical system, wiring, capacitors, controls, and other key components after a suspected surge. Professional testing helps identify damaged parts before they cause wider problems.
Fast service also helps protect the compressor. Compressor damage usually leads to a much larger repair bill than replacing a smaller electrical component. Prompt inspection gives your technician a clear view of the system and helps restore reliable cooling.
Protecting your AC from power spikes
A whole-home surge protector offers an extra layer of protection against sudden voltage increases. An HVAC technician can also inspect the AC electrical connections and recommend suitable protection for your system.
Keep your AC serviced at regular intervals as well. Clean components and healthy electrical connections support stable operation during demanding summer conditions. If your system behaves strangely after a power outage or storm, turn it off and arrange a professional inspection.
